WebThe GCF of 117 and 182 is 13. Steps to find GCF. Find the prime factorization of 117 117 = 3 × 3 × 13; Find the prime factorization of 182 182 = 2 × 7 × 13; To find the GCF, multiply all the prime factors common to both numbers: Therefore, GCF = 13; MathStep (Works offline) Download our mobile app and learn how to find GCF of upto four ...

The greatest common factor (GCF) of a set of numbers is the largest positive integer that divides each of the numbers evenly. It's also called the greatest common divisor (GCD).
